BJP Demands Narco Test for Ex-Mumbai Police Chief Sanjay Pandey in Alleged Plot Against Fadnavis
BJP seeks narco test for ex-cop Sanjay Pandey in Fadnavis plot

The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) in Mumbai has made a significant demand, calling for a narcoanalysis test on former city police commissioner Sanjay Pandey. The party alleges he was central to a conspiracy to falsely implicate then Opposition leader, and now Chief Minister, Devendra Fadnavis, during the tenure of the Maha Vikas Aghadi (MVA) government.

The Alleged Conspiracy and Key Accusations

Mumbai BJP president Ameet Satam, addressing reporters on Saturday, presented a series of serious allegations. He claimed that during the MVA regime led by then Chief Minister Uddhav Thackeray, a plot was orchestrated to have Devendra Fadnavis arrested on fabricated charges. According to Satam, former police chief Sanjay Pandey was instructed to execute this plan and subsequently assigned the task to two police officers.

Satam named the officers as Laxmikant Patil and Sardar Patil. He alleged they were approached and pressured to find or create a case to frame Fadnavis, who was the leader of the opposition in the state legislative assembly at the time. Satam linked this alleged conspiracy to a broader pattern of misconduct, referencing shocking incidents involving police officials like Sachin Waze during the MVA rule.

Basis for the Demand and Call for Probe

The BJP leader stated that all details of this alleged plot are documented in a report submitted by former Director General of Police (DGP) Rashmi Shukla to the government. This report was filed just five days before her retirement. Citing the gravity of the matter, Satam called for a thorough investigation.

"I urge the government to do a narco test of Sanjay Pandey," Satam asserted. He emphasized that it is crucial to identify who gave Pandey the orders, stating, "It is necessary to know at whose behest Pandey was carrying out the work to frame Fadnavis in false cases. The real mastermind behind this should be brought to the public."

Context and Political Backdrop

This demand adds a new chapter to Maharashtra's turbulent political landscape. In 2019, Uddhav Thackeray's Shiv Sena broke its alliance with the BJP to form the MVA government with the Congress and the NCP, pushing the BJP into opposition. The political equations shifted again in 2022 when Eknath Shinde split the Shiv Sena and became Chief Minister with BJP support, making Fadnavis the Deputy Chief Minister.

Satam also noted that Sanjay Pandey is currently out on bail and is himself under investigation by the Enforcement Directorate (ED) in connection with the NSE co-location scam, with the matter pending in court. The BJP's demand intensifies the ongoing political feud and raises questions about the use of state machinery during the previous administration.

These allegations first gained public attention in 2023 when Fadnavis himself revealed there had been a conspiracy to frame him in false cases and have him imprisoned. The BJP's latest move seeks to force a judicial or investigative resolution to these long-standing claims.
